Please donât forget to charge your phone before you leave for the Amex and download your tickets to your phone's wallet. Have your pass ready before you get to the turnstiles.
The tickets appear at the bottom of your phone's wallet below any payment cards you may have.
If you have an Android phone that doesnât have NFC, youâll have a 'Show Code' option to allow you to scan a barcode instead. Alternatively, tickets can be printed off at home and brought with you.
If youâre attending the match as a large group, please print your tickets off and hand them out to every individual in the group before the game. Otherwise, you can get your tickets printed at the ticket office on matchday. If you wish to use digital tickets, please ensure these have been downloaded to each individual's phone beforehand. This will mean that everyone is able to get through the turnstiles quicker.

Bags and Bottles
Please do not bring bags to the stadium; if you do so, the maximum permitted size will be A4 (297mm x 210mm). Any oversized bags may be left at the Bag Drop (ÂŁ7.50 charge), and any bags left outside the stadium will be removed and disposed of.
Bottles must be clear plastic, 500ml or less with no bottle cap to be permitted on entrance. Please do not bring metal water bottles.
